Predicted Newcastle line-up to face a Tottenham in the Premier League

Newcastle were in dreamland after the conclusion of the midweek fixtures as they found themselves at 14th place, 5 points clear of the relegation zone.

This was thanks to what was by far their best performance of the season, as they beat Manchester City 2-1 against all the odds at St.James’ Park.

They fought like warriors for the entire 90 minutes and apart from a lapse in concentration 27 seconds into the game, they were solid, structurally and mentally. Rafa has got a positive reaction from the players and will be hoping to move forward.

Team News

Jonjo Shelvey, Mo Diame and Ki Sung-Yeung are all very close to returning from various injuries but will mostly have to do with places on the bench.

Karl Darlow is also recovering well and could be in contention for the next match. Apart from this, Paul Dummett and Joselu remain unavailable while Yoshinori Muto is representing Japan at the AFC Asian Cup.

Probable Newcastle United XI

Formation: 5-4-1

Manager: Rafael Benitez

GK – Martin Dubravka

The Slovakian is expected to keep his place for this massive clash against Spurs despite Darlow’s gradual recovery.

RWB – DeAndre Yedlin

The American international full-back has been very good going forward this season and his powerful crosses will certainly aid Salomon Rondón.

RCB – Fabian Schar

The Swiss international defender has been solid since making the starting place his own. Even managed to score a brace against Cardiff a couple of weeks ago.

CB – Jamaal Lascelles

The Englishman has been a rock at the back this season and deserves a lot of credit for the way he has led the team from the front since taking over the armband.

LCB – Florian Lejeune

Another player who has really come to the fore at the right time for Rafa, expect the Frenchman to keep his place in the heart of the Newcastle defence.

LWB – Matt Ritchie

The man who scored the winning penalty against Manchester City on Tuesday, the make-shift right-back is really owning his role and rewarding his manager’s trust.

RM – Ayoze Perez

The Spaniard is the Magpies’ most creative player and when he’s in the mood, he brings huge potency to the Newcastle front-line.

RCM – Issac Hayden

One of the two brilliant young midfielders who forms Newcastle’s engine room, Hayden has been sensational since coming into the line-up to cover for injuries.

LCM – Sean Longstaff

The player who makes Newcastle United tick, Longstaff has made the midfield role his own.

LM – Christian Atsu

The former Chelsea man has bags of pace and is capable of the odd special goal. His strong running and early crosses will be key in this match.

ST – Salomon Rondón

When given the right kind of chances, Rondón will always score them. He is a target man and when used properly, he can be extremely devastating.
